Output 101f59b4b3e8afa63d89c6ca4d659bd686650fadd06b32da09d33dddbee0f0c1:0

value
997849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1204e2bdec3ace4722ac757dcb2b01fdccce1c44 OP_EQUAL
address
33LHwTjooQMcmMPiBUMJomcZyHAxmmH1sm
transaction
101f59b4b3e8afa63d89c6ca4d659bd686650fadd06b32da09d33dddbee0f0c1
confirmations
316948
spent
true